~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 The Troubles is a generic term used to describe a period of sporadic communal violence involving paramilitary organisations, the Royal Ulster Constabulary, the British Army and others in Northern Ireland from the late 1960s until the mid-1990s. It could also be described as a many-sided conflict, a guerrilla war or even a civil war. The Provisional IRA maintained their violent campaign was armed resistance to British occupation. They are described by many governments (including the Irish and British) as a terrorist organisation. 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~
